The Beladau dagger is coming from Sumatra and from Mentawi island. Characterized by a short curved double edged blade. It is the best example of the influence of Arab Jambiya daggers on Indonesian blades.

The Beladau dagger offered here is a perfect exemplar. Short curved double edged blade forged from pamor steel.  Horn  hilt with beautifully carved pommel. Black horn scabbard with silver bands

Blade 5 inches. Total length 9 inches. very good condition.

For a very similar Beladau see: Albert G. van Zonneveld “Traditional Weapons of the Indonesian Archipelago”, page 33 Fig 65.
Provenance: IFICAH International Foundation of Indonesian Culture and Asian Heritage, Hollenstedt (Germany)
